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 2024 release date window prediction

So, CES 2024 will set the stage for the OLED G9 2024 announcement. In fact, that’s exactly what we saw last year at CES 2023 when Samsung announced their previous OLED G9 model. Based on what we’ve seen in the past, we don’t expect the new display to release right away, nor within January. Last year, it took until June for the OLED G9 to be released – and we expect this timeframe to repeat itself in 2024.

With that, we predict that the new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 will release in late Q2 or early Q3 2024. It honestly seems like it would be too early to launch yet another OLED G9 – especially since Samsung already released two different variants during 2023 (the G95SC and G93SC), the latter coming without the additional smart features. So we don’t expect Q1 for example.

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 2024 price speculation

Moving on to the price of the new OLED G9, and we don’t expect it to be much cheaper than previous iterations. To refresh your memory, let’s have a look at pricing so far on release:

  •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 G95SC price: $2,199.99
  •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 G93SC price: $1,599.99

The G93SC did arrive a few months later and falls $200 under the newer $1,799.99 price of the G95SC, so the price of the OLED G9 2024 may follow suit and drop in price not too long after it launches. Either way, on launch, we expect this 2024 model to retail close to the $2000 mark, as it will indeed include the Samsung Smart TV and Gaming Hub features.

Will the new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 be worth it?

Whether the new Samsung Odyssey OLED G9 will be worth it or not is a matter of what you want from the display. As per the details Samsung have release so far, the it features largely the same specs as the G95SC, but with some ‘other upgraded features’. It is called the G95SD model, which is evidently a small step up. The panel will feature OLED Glare-Free technology and have been upgraded to now feature Multi Control for easier device connectivity and control of other Samsung devices.

Overall, we don’t think it’s worth buying if you already have a previous OLED G9 model. However, if you’re looking for the very latest tech and want all your Samsung devices easily synced to one place, it’s an appealing option. The initial price tag will certainty be a big ask for many though.
